Golden Dome missile shield moves forward.

U.S. Space Command has submitted its recommendations for the "Golden Dome" missile defense system to SecDef. The proposed system aims to deploy space-based interceptors to neutralize hypersonic threats, drawing parallels to Reagan's "Star Wars" initiative. Estimated costs are included, aligning with POTUS’ proposed $1 trillion defense budget for 2026. ​

DISA's Endguard fortifies Navy's cyber readiness.

DISA's new Endguard platform is bolstering the Navy's Readiness Reporting Enterprise by enhancing endpoint security with Microsoft Defender. This initiative marks the first of 192 planned migrations through FY27, aiming to provide real-time threat detection and improved cyber defense across the Department of Defense.​

Pentagon turns to ground-based radars to address gaps in space domain awareness.

To keep an eye on what’s happening up there, the Space Force is investing in ground-based radars down here. With satellite threats growing—especially from China—leaders want better space domain awareness, and that means more ISR coverage from terra firma.

POTUS orders major overhaul of federal procurement rules​.

POTUS has signed yet more E.O.s to revamp federal procurement processes, aiming to simplify the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) and prioritize commercially available products. Agencies have tight deadlines: 15 days to designate procurement leads, 20 days for OMB guidance, and 60 days to review non-commercial contracts.

NIST aligns privacy framework with cybersecurity guidelines.

NIST updates its Privacy Framework to sync with Cybersecurity Framework 2.0, making it easier for organizations to tackle privacy and cybersecurity risks together. The draft includes AI-focused privacy tools and a user-friendly FAQ section.

OSTP Director advocates creative R&D funding strategies.

In his first public address since Senate confirmation, OSTP Director Michael Kratsios emphasized the need for “smart choices” in allocating R&D funding and accelerating award processes.
